Pumpkin Whoopie Pies

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ree (canned or fresh)
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up brown sugar (packed)
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• ½ cup unsalted butter (melted)
  • 4 oz cream cheese (softened)
  • 1 cup powdered sugar

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large bowl, mix pumpkin puree, brown sugar, and melted butter until smooth.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together flour, cinnamon, baking soda, and salt.
  4. Gradually combine dry ingredients with the wet mixture until just combined.
  5. Drop spoonfuls of batter onto lined baking sheets, spacing them apart.
  6. Bake for 12-15 minutes until fluffy and lightly golden.
  7. Allow to cool before preparing the filling by whipping cream cheese and powdered sugar together until smooth.
  8. Spread filling on one cookie half and sandwich with another.
